Your health is important to you around the clock–not just during office hours. The myMemorialCare myChart electronic medical record, powered by Epic’s myChart is your personalized Internet connection to your doctor’s office. You can schedule appointments, request prescription refills, review your health history and more—online, any time.

Please do not use myChart to send any messages requiring urgent attention. For urgent medical matters, contact your doctor's office. For medical emergencies call 9-1-1.
